LED(Light Emitting Diode,发光二极管)是一种半导体器件,能够将电能直接转换为光能。LED积木是一种教育玩具,通常用于帮助儿童学习电子电路和编程基础。
// 定义LED灯的引脚
int ledPins[10] = {2, 3, 4, 5, 6, 7, 8, 9, 10, 11};
void setup() {
// 设置LED灯引脚为输出模式
for (int i = 0; i < 10; i++) {
pinMode(ledPins[i], OUTPUT);
}
}
void loop() {
// 依次点亮10个LED灯
for (int i = 0; i < 10; i++) {
digitalWrite(ledPins[i], HIGH);
delay(500); // 延时500毫秒
digitalWrite(ledPins[i], LOW);
}
}
通过以上步骤和示例代码,你可以制作一个包含10个LED灯的积木,并通过编程控制它们的亮度和颜色。希望这些信息对你有所帮助!
领取专属 10元无门槛券
手把手带您无忧上云